  3. 5 minutes ago, Turtles06 said:

    The Jewel-class ships, including the Gem, do not have reserved shows. 
     

    You can book specialty dining, and it’s a good idea to do so, especially if you are looking for specific dates and times. With NCL handing out the “free at sea” meals, and with the inflated levels of Platinum and above Latitudes members, the specialty venues can be pretty crowded.

  13. On 5/25/2023 at 2:16 AM, BirdTravels said:

    Redeploy means that the ship is going on another itinerary. She isn’t sitting idol for 4 months. A lot of times it means the former itinerary was undersold and they pulled the plug. Move the ship somewhere where she will make more money. 
     

    Once before, they tried to keep the Epic in Europe year round. There was little interest to sail the Med during the winter and the abandoned  the idea. Sounds like it happened again. 

    There is interest to cruise the Med Christmas/New Year .

    The Spirit did several before it was moved after refit . The Sun was sold out last year for Christmas/New Year and when we booked the Epic there was limited availability for balcony cabins on 10/11 and 12.

     

    The Canaries are warm and sunny (shorts and t shirt weather )...so I don't think it is lack of interest.

  14. 22 hours ago, mking8288 said:

    We're just on 13041 for 15 nights TA, which is practically the mirror image of 13071 - these are basically directly above 11073 and 11099 - ours are "B4" family balconies that sleep up to 4 (very tight for 4, just okay for 3, best for 2, really) 

     

    Ours are one of the secret, angled balcony that's quite large, 90 to 100 sq. ft. or double the size of the "regular" balconies on the Epic.  Yours would be next door to us, that sleep only 3, officially designated as a B6 large balcony, truthfully, not that much bigger than ours - where we could've possible put 2 reclining loungers, if not 3 outside, plus room for a round or square table instead of the tiny coffee/end table.  

     

    Great location, quiet as you have cabins above & below - yours have Inside staterooms across, ours - opposite the white space, which housed the service elevators and crew stairs, storage & restricted corridor used by crews, etc.  Garden Cafe, La Cucina, O'Sheehan's are all FWD on the Epic, access to the Taste MDR also best from the front stairs & elevators.
